MySQL入门指南:安装、操作与实战
需积分: 3 102 浏览量
更新于2024-08-18
收藏 995KB PPT 举报
MySQL简介
MySQL是一种小型关系型数据库管理系统,由瑞典MySQL AB公司开发,自2008年被Sun公司收购后,最终于2009年被Oracle公司继承。它因体积小、速度快和成本低等特点,在互联网上的中小型网站中广泛应用。MySQL支持开放源码,这意味着用户可以自由地查看、修改和分发其代码。
本文档详细介绍了如何在Windows环境中安装MySQL。安装步骤包括下载MySQL绿色版.rar(通常存储在svn103\工具\目录下)进行解压,以及安装mysql客户端rar包,以便后续的数据库管理和操作。对于初学者,连接MySQL服务器的过程也做了说明,通过运行mysql_start.bat和mysql_open.bat脚本,并输入相应的密码即可完成连接和初步测试。
在数据库管理方面,文档涵盖了以下几个核心主题:
1. 创建数据库:用户可以使用"CreatedatabasedbName;"语句来创建一个新的数据库,而"DropdatabasedbName;"则用于删除不再需要的数据库。数据库命名应遵循一定的规则。
2. 表的创建:MySQL支持多种字段类型,如Int(整数,有符号和无符号两种范围)、Varchar和Char(变长和定长字符串)、Double和Float(浮点数,单精度和双精度)、Date和DATETIME(日期和日期时间,有特定的范围限制)。主键(primary key)和外键(foreign key)约束是创建表时的重要概念,主键用来唯一标识数据记录,而外键则用来表示记录之间的关联关系。
3. 约束条件:在定义表结构时,可以通过添加约束来确保数据的完整性。例如,主键约束(primary key)确保每个字段值的唯一性,而外键约束(References)则用于引用其他表的主键,维护数据的一致性。
本资源提供了一个全面的MySQL入门指南,涵盖了从安装、连接到基本的数据库和表操作,以及关键的约束概念,对初学者和有一定经验的开发者都是宝贵的学习资料。无论是学习MySQL的基本用法还是进行实际项目开发,这个文档都是一份实用的参考。
点击了解资源详情
点击了解资源详情
点击了解资源详情
710 浏览量
2009-05-12 上传
2022-07-25 上传
1267 浏览量
246 浏览量
ServeRobotics
- 粉丝: 39
- 资源: 2万+
最新资源
- 《Linux服务器搭建实战详解》-pdf
- java爬虫的实例代码+java清除空文件夹的代码
- Project1:使用HTML,CSS和引导程序创建的响应式投资组合网页
- Catfish(鲶鱼) Blog v1.1.9
- ROG-Phone-2-Switch-WW-Stock-ROM
- 社交媒体演示
- gatsby-shopify-toy-store-test
- 使用MATLAB分析车队测试数据:在线讲座“使用MATLAB分析车队测试数据”中的文件-matlab开发
- 汽车销售管理系统-毕业设计
- 台达A2伺服说明说.rar
- 商品销售系统源码.rar
- c33
- 校无忧人事工资系统 v2.5
- react-contentful-nextjs-tutorial:使用适用于SSR或Jamstack的NextJS React x Contentful
- 视频编码器
- Rapla, resource scheduling-开源